Output 3c87650c760b008896980466a82a1517f5b07acc38cffd2913ff0bbd5ade8dff:0

value
580378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e7ca18b5465c62bf16097eac5c9c220cd64fbf5 OP_EQUAL
address
38r1w2FofXRNCMpnJokBwZhVfghvGZC3wA
transaction
3c87650c760b008896980466a82a1517f5b07acc38cffd2913ff0bbd5ade8dff
spent
true